Abstract:

When inclined ore bodies are mined with caving mining method,the mining intensity and production capacity are poor,the ore loss and dilution are high,the surface subsidence area is large and the land area occupied by the mine is large,greatly reducing the mining economics of caving mining method.Therefore,the mining of inclined ore bodies are deemed as the restricted area for caving method.According to the rock caving rules,loose body movement rules and crustal pressure activities rule adaptation theory,the efficient mining technology of zoned caving mining based on big caving span in mined-out area is proposed,which employs relatively big structural parameter to extract primary ore bodies,recovers residual ores in the foot wall in two steps through the recovery approach,and solves the contradiction between mining efficiency and ore loss and dilution;the rock movement range is controlled with filling collapse pit method based on critical loose body column support theory.Application practice shows that the technology effectively solves the challenge facing caving mining method when inclined ore bodies are mined and increases the mine production capacity to 4 million t/a,and the mining loss rate and ore dilution rate are controlled at 14.8 % and 12.6 % respectively,the surface collapse angle is 76° inward inclined.The method achieves green and efficient mining with low dilution and loss.
